What is the Wall Royale Event Free Fire’s most popular Gloo Wall spin event
The Wall Royale event is Free Fire’s exclusive Luck Royale event, where only Gloo Wall skins are awarded. This time, the Wall Royale December 2025 “current Gloo Wall event” was released with the OB52 update. You spin with diamonds, and each spin yields a new reward. The most important thing is that no item is duplicated, and the grand prize is guaranteed after completing 50 spins.

Purple Gorilla, Kelly Anime, and several Limited Edition skins are available only in this event. The OB52 update also added the Gloo Wall Relay mode and a new Wrecking Gadget. This gadget provides 50% more damage and a 30 DMG explosion on the Gloo Wall, making battles even more intense.
How much Diamond will it cost to win the Wall Royale event A simple calculation
- This question is on every player’s mind. One spin in the event costs 9 DM, and 10+1 spins cost 90 DM.
Garena’s reward system is random, so there’s no set formula. - But based on average player results and previous events:
- It generally takes 450 to 900 diamonds to win the grand prize.
- Some players get it for as little as 300 DM, while others have to go as far as 450 DM in 50 spins.

Is the 1 Spin Trick in the Wall Royale Event real

This trick is spreading widely on social media claiming to win a skin in one spin.
- But Garena has already clarified:
- The 1 Spin Trick in Wall Royale is purely a rumor.
- Rewards operate on a RNG (random) system.
So it is better that you do not trust fake tricks and focus on the real mechanism of the game.
